David Tennant Does a Podcast with... - DT just having a conversation with various celebrities, I enjoyed many of them.


Similarly A Podcast of Ones Own with Julia Gillard talking to various other women about feminism, leadership etc.


This American Life - variety.


Nice White Parents- by the same people who do This American Life, Serial etc so it is well produced and is about racial segregation of American schools and the various failed attempts to integrate them.


And for much lighter content, Hamish and Andy got me through lockdown/2020 - I walked for hours getting through their back catalogue (start from the beginning as there are lots of running jokes) and they are just silly and funny and a good mood lifter.


The Pineapple Project was pretty good too - they had a few different seasons on various topics - one about money/ budgeting, one about work, one about managing clutter, etc.

I really like You're Wrong About.


And also some history ones, The History Chicks is really good and talks about women in history at some length. I really like Stuff You Missed in History Class as well.


This Podcast Will Kill You is really interesting if you have a strong stomach - it is about the history of various diseases.

Another for if you like science at all is RN Presents ‘Patient Zero’. It’s a short series (season one has 4 eps, season 2 has only just started but I think it’s another 4). Each covers a specific disease outbreak- how it was first noticed and how the pathogen responsible was identified. Sooo good.
